Yazılımcı Kimdir?
Yazılımcı, belirli işlevlere sahip uygulamalar geliştirebilen uzmanlardır. Bir yazılımcının, üzerinde çalıştığı platformu, kullandığı teknolojileri iyi tanıması ve bilgisayarın anlayacağı mantıksal dilde düşünebilmesi gerekir. Yazılımcılar bir proje takımında veya çalıştıkları şirketlerde üstlendikleri görevlere göre çeşitli unvanlar alırlar.
Yazılım Uzmanı Ne Yapar? Yazılım Uzmanının Görev Sorumlulukları Neleri Kapsar?
Bilgisayar programlarının ve elektronik cihazların harekete geçmesini sağlayan yazılımları üreten yazılım uzmanlarının başlıca görevleri şunlardır:
-Mobil cihazlarda, bilgisayarda ya da yazılım kullanılan farklı ortam içerisinde sistem geliştirmek,
-Söz konusu ortamlarda yazılım tasarlamak,
-Yazılım ve sistemlerin geliştirilmesini sağlamak,
-Yazılım ve sistemlerin tasarımından bakımına, test edilmesinden değerlendirilmesine kadar olan tüm aşamaları takip etmek ve kontrol altında tutmak,
-Teknolojinin gelişmesiyle değişen yazılım sektörüne ayak uydurmak için sürekli araştırma yapmak,
-İşletim sistemleri kurmak,
-Yazılımların hatasız çalışması için çözümler üretmek.
Nasıl Yazılım Uzmanı Olunur?
Yazılım uzmanlığı için üniversite eğitimi şart değildir. Üniversitelerin Bilgisayar Mühendisliği ya da Yazılım Mühendisliği gibi alanlarında eğitim almak, daha donanımlı bir yazılım uzmanı olmanızı sağlar. Özel kurum ya da kamu kurumlarında verilen kurslardan faydalanarak sertifika sahibi olabilir ve kendinizi geliştirebilirsiniz.
Bu sayfamızda Yazılımcılar için Motivasyonel Yazılımcı Sözleri ve Espirili Yazılımcı Sözleri derledik.
MOTİVASYONEL YAZILIMCI SÖZLERİ
Bilgi güçtür. -Francis Bacon
Benim makinemde çalışıyor. -Anonim
Acı çekmeden öğrenemeyiz. -Aristotle
İlerlemenin sırrı başlamaktır. -Mark Twain
Önce meseleyi çözün. Sonra kodu yazın. -Anonim
Beta Latince’de “Hala çalışmıyor” demektir. -Anonim
Yazılımcı; kahveyi koda çeviren organizma. -Anonim
Hızlı, İyi, Ucuz. Sadece ikisini seçebilirsin. -Bilinmiyor
Konuşmak bedava, bana kodu göster! -Linus Torvalds
Basitlik, güvenilirlik için önkoşuldur. -Edsger W. Dijkstra
Odaklanmak, 1000 iyi fikre hayır diyebilmektir. -Steve Jobs
Kod yalan söylemez, yorumlar bazen söyler. -Ron Jeffries
Tasarım, nasıl başarısız olacağınızı seçmektir. -Ron Fein
Mücadele yoksa ilerleme de yoktur. -Frederick Douglass
Sorunun kaynağını düzeltin, semptomunu değil. -Steve Maguir
Kod, espiri gibidir. Açıklamak zorundaysanız kötüdür. -Cory House
Okulumun eğitimimi engellemesine asla izin vermedim. -Mark Twain
Eğer gerçekler teorinize uymuyorsa gerçekliği değiştirin. -Albert Einstein
Merak duygusunun zorunlu eğitimden sağ çıkması mucize. -Albert Einstein
Asla yanlış yapmamış insan, yeni hiçbir şey denememiştir. -Albert Einstein
Eğer fikrinizi yazıya dökemiyorsanız, onu kodlayamazsınız. -Peter Halper
Yazılım, yapmasını söylediğiniz işi yapar, yapmasını istediğinizi değil. -Anonim
Mükemmel fikirleri çalmak konusunda her zaman yüzsüz davrandık. -Steve Jobs
Kullanıcıları, sistemin zaten bildiği bir bilgiyi vermeye zorlamayın. -Rick Lemons
Bir projeyi daha hızlı bitirmenin en iyi yolu, erkenden başlamaktır. -Jim Highsmith
İyi bir yazılımcı, tek yön bir yoldan karşıya geçerken iki yöne de bakandır. -Anonim
Daha az kod yazmak, esnek kalmanın güzel bir yoludur. -Pragmatic Programmer
Mantık sizi A noktasından B noktasına götürür. Hayal gücü her yere. -Albert Einstein
Kötü yönetim yazılım maliyetini diğer tüm faktörlerden daha hızlı arttırır. -Barry Boehm
Kodunuzda NE yerine NEDEN’e odaklanmak sizi daha iyi bir geliştirici yapar. -Jordi Boggiano
İnsanlar, yazılımın ürün olmadığını, ürün üretmek için kullanıldığını anlayacaklar. -Linus Torvalds
En iyi performans arttırımı, çalışmayan durumdan çalışır duruma getirmektir. -John Ousterhout
İnternetten bulunan kodu canlıdaki koda yapıştırmak, yolda bulunan sakızı çiğnemek gibidir. Anonim
Servislerinizi birbirinden bağımsız olarak ayağa kaldıramıyorsanız mikroservis değillerdir. -Daniel Bryant
Ben sadece icat ederim. Sonra insanların gelip icadıma ihtiyaç duymasını beklerim. -R. Buckminster Fuller
Performansın anahtarı zarafettir. Binlerce özel durum gerçekleştirimi değildir. -Jon Bentley. Doug MvIlroy
Ancak ikisi de donmuşsa suda yürümek ve şartnameden yazılım geliştirmek kolaydır. -Edward V Berard
Debug sırasında, acemiler hata giderici kod eklerler; uzmanlar ise kusurlu olan kodu çıkarırlar. -Richard Pattis
Tüm büyük programlama felaketleri çok fazla fikri alıp tek bir yere koymaktan kaynaklanmıştır. Gordon Bell
Gereksinim veya tasarım olmadan programlama, boş bir dosyaya bug eklemekten başka bir şey değildir. -Louis Srygley
Programlamadaki ilerleyişi yazılan kod satırı sayısıyla ölçmek, uçak inşasındaki ilerleyişi ağırlıkla ölçmeye benzer. -Bill Gates
Programcılar, geleceği düşündükleri için sürekli olarak işleri gereğinden fazla karmaşıklaştırmaktadırlar. Geleceği boşverin. Bugün için programlayın. -David Heinemeier Hansson
Neden hiçbir zaman DOĞRU yapmak için vaktimiz yok da YENİDEN yapmak için vaktimiz var? -Anonim
Bazen pazartesi günü tüm gün yatmak, haftanın kalanını Pazartesi yazılan kodu debug etmeye harcamaktan iyidir. -Dan Salomon
Üretken bir programcının işe alınabilir olmasını beklemek, ilk bulunan programcının üretken olmasını beklemekten iyidir. -Bjarne Stroustrup
Tasarımda mükemmellik, ekleyecek bir şey kalmadığında değil, çıkaracak bir şey kalmadığında yakalanır.
Antonie de Saint-Exupery
Gizemli bir cinayetin sırlarını çözmek iyidir. Fakat kodun sırlarını çözmek zorunda kalmamalısınız. Kodun kolaylıkla anlaşılabilir olması gerekir. -Steve McConnell
Esprili Yazılımcı Sözleri
“Kodlaya kodlaya göl olur”
“40 katır mı 40 satır mı?” “yazılım zor iş!”
“Stajyer scriptini windows’um diye severmiş”
“Gerçek programcı çay makinesini bile kodlayabilir.”
“El elin kodunu türkü çağıra çağıra debug edermiş”
“O kod c# kodu, bu kod java kodu, peki bu kodu kim kodu…”
Programlama, bisiklete binmek gibidir; asla unutulmaz, yalnızca pratik gerektirir.
“Bir resim bin kelimeye bedeldir. (ve bu yüzden yüklemesi bin kat daha uzun sürer!)” -Eric Tilton
“Gençlere nasihat verirken çok dikkatli olmalıyız, bazen dikkate alırlar” -Edsger W. Djikstra”
“Bilgisayar bilimlerinin bilgisayarlarla alakası, astronominin teleskopla alakasından fazla değildir.” -Edsger Dijkstra
“Eğer c++ dilinin gereğinden fazla karmaşık olmadığını düşünüyorsanız bana ‘protected abstract virtual base pure virtual private destructor’ın ne olduğunu söyleyin” (Tom Cargill, c++ journal 1990)
!Sizde sayfamızda “Motivasyonel Yazılımcı Sözleri“ paylaşmak isterseniz aşağıda bulunan yorum bölümünden Motivasyonel Yazılımcı Sözleri’ni ekleyebilirsiniz.